Jill Gallaher

June 04, 1968 ~ July 30, 2025

Jill Ann Gallaher, 57 of Vero Beach, Florida passed away on July 30, 2025 after a sudden illness.

 

Jill was born in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ania on June 4, 1968 to parents Judy and Joe Gallaher. She moved to Vero Beach with her family in June of 1978. Jill graduated from Vero Beach High School in 1986 and Indian River State College in 1991. She began her career at Grand Harbor and held management positions with Windsor Club, Oak Harbor and Indian River Club.

 

Jill is survived by her daughter Sydney Lyons; parents Judy and Joe Gallaher; brother Joe Gallaher Jr; (sister in law Martha Sue Gallaher) and nephew Ryan Gallaher. In keeping with Jill’s loving and generous spirit, it was her wish to donate life so others may live. Jill’s gifts will help save other lives and her spirit will live on because of her generosity. The family requests that others consider signing up for Organ Donation in your state or municipality.

 

A celebration of life will be scheduled at later date. Memorial contributions in Jill’s name may be made to H.A.L.O. No-Kill Rescue Shelter, 710 Jackson Street, Sebastian, Florida 32958 or via the website: https://halorescuefl.org and selecting “Donate” and then “Make a Tribute or Memorial Donation”. Another option for a memorial donation would be the Humane Society of Indian River County, 6230, 7th St, Vero Beach, Florida 32967, or via the website: https://hsvb.org/ and select Donate” and then select “Make a Memorial / Honor Donation”.

Direct Cremation Fee Includes

  • Transportation from the place of death to our family owned crematory
  • Basic alternative cremation container
  • Refrigeration of your loved one
  • Cremation performed by our crematory professional
  • Securing all required authorizations
  • Filing the death certificate
  • Notifying social security administration
  • If veteran, filing for free US flag
  • Assisting with newspaper obituaries
  • Cremains are returned to you in a temporary container

Other Fees That May Apply

  • Medical Examiner (fees vary by county)
  • Transportation outside 35 miles
  • Death certificates (fees vary by county)
  • Newspaper Obituaries (fee charged by newspaper)
  • Keepsakes
  • Permanent Urn
  • Jewelry
